I got this to treat some small field crops for insects. It was way too large an area to use a pump-up sprayer and too small (and too covered with crops) to have a commercial applicator spray it. I had looked at the Stihl products which do the same thing but the one which was most similar to this was $719 (apparently "on sale", regularly $749). Ouch, that's a lot of money to see if a solution will work. I found this one and gambled that, at $400 less, it would function well enough to get the job done. It very much does.I also expected that, being on Amazon, and being this inexpensive, it would be made in China. However, I have not found a "Made in xxxxx" marking on the unit, but the branding of the unit indicates the brand, Invatech, and "Italia". Italia is Italy. While that's not as conclusive as a clear marking of "Made in Italy", I believe, based on the markings and the quality of the build, that it was made in Italy.It was easy to assemble and came with some spare parts I didn't expect (like a spare pull-start unit). The unit fired up immediately the first time and I had no problems with the carburetor functioning as-is out of the box. Some reviews mention having to adjust the carburetor, and there's a tool in the box to do so. FWIW, I'm at about 1,000 feet elevation, and elevation can have an impact on carbureted engines. The only negative I can say about this aspect of the unit is that the carburetor adjustment tool comes wrapped separately and has a label indicating that opening the bag with the tool "will void the warranty". What the...you include a tool to adjust the unit then tell the user that if they use the tool they void their warranty? What a bunch of garbage...you could open the bag, use the tool, throw the tool and the bag in the trash, who's gonna know? The Draconian warning about the warranty when it's so obviously un-provable whether you opened the bag or not is offputting.Anyway, the unit has worked well. The shoulder straps were very padded and easy to adjust. The unit is easy to operate and has functioned well.The instructions indicate that filling the tank with no more than 2 gallons of fluid is recommended. They're not kidding. Each gallon of water weighs, approximately, 8 pounds and the unit can hold 4 gallons...that's roughly 32 pounds of water on top of the unit weight which I recall to be about 25 pounds. I'm 6' 1" and not exactly scrawny and 2 gallons in the unit was quite enough, thank you. They advise using an elevated platform to mount and dismount the unit from your back and that is highly recommended. I set it on the tailgate of my truck, but a sturdy table would work just fine. Just don't try to mount it on your back directly from the ground; that would be a bit much.Overall, I'm very pleased with the unit, especially at the price. The process of spraying the crops in this manner has worked for us. We weren't sure, so spending a lot less money on this versus the Stihl was a logical choice. That choice has worked out well.

This obviously doesn’t come fully assembled in the box lol and despite others reviews it actually quite easy to assemble, maybe 15 mins for me. Very easy to use but I have only used it as a liquid mister and haven’t tried the dry fogger option (that takes modification to the unit but all is provided in the box) the 2L pop bottle in the photo is for size comparison. Unit weighs roughly 22lbs Empty (no fuel, no spray liquid) so only fill to what you can lift! That’s my advice and happy fogging!
